How Indices Brokers Work for Tonga Traders

Trading indices through a broker means you are buying or selling Contracts for Difference (CFDs) on a stock market index, such as the Dow Jones, NASDAQ, or ASX 200. Unlike buying physical shares, you never own the underlying assets β€” you speculate on price movements. For Tonga traders, this is especially practical because you can trade global markets directly from your computer or phone without needing a local stock exchange. Most brokers on our list β€” including Pepperstone, AvaTrade, and Exness β€” offer indices CFDs with leverage, meaning you can control a large position with a small deposit. For example, a $100 deposit with XM Group (minimum $5) could give you exposure to the S&P 500 worth $500 or more, depending on leverage limits set by the broker. However, leverage amplifies both gains and losses, so risk management is key. Indices are less volatile than individual stocks but still move on economic news, interest rate decisions, and geopolitical events. For Tonga, where the internet can be intermittent, using a broker with a robust mobile app (like eToro or OctaFX) or a VPS service (as offered by Fusion Markets) helps maintain stable connectivity during key trading hours.

Scalping Strategy

Scalping indices involves opening and closing trades within seconds to minutes, profiting from tiny price movements. For Tonga traders, this requires a broker that allows scalping, offers low spreads, and has fast execution β€” preferably with a local VPS server. Pepperstone (4.4/5) is a top choice: it permits scalping, has spreads from 0.0 pips on indices, and provides VPS hosting for high-frequency traders. Exness (4.1/5) also supports scalping with no restrictions and offers instant execution. However, your internet connection in Tonga may introduce latency β€” average ping to a European server can be 300–400 ms, which is risky for scalping. To overcome this, use a VPS located near the broker’s server (e.g., London for FTSE 100 scalping). IC Markets (3.6/5) offers raw spreads and a dedicated scalping account, but its minimum deposit of $200 may be high for beginners. Avoid brokers like eToro (3.7/5), which does not permit scalping due to its social trading model. A good strategy for Tonga: scalp the S&P 500 during the US session (2:30 AM–9:00 AM Tonga time) using a 1-minute chart and a tight stop-loss. Keep your position size small β€” 0.1 lots β€” to manage risk given potential slippage from your remote location.

Economic Calendar

For Tonga-based traders focusing on indices, the most impactful economic events are those from major economies that drive index movements. The US Non-Farm Payrolls (NFP) report, released on the first Friday of each month at 8:30 AM Eastern Time (which is 1:30 AM Tonga time the next day), often triggers volatility in US indices like the S&P 500 and Nasdaq. Similarly, the Federal Reserve's interest rate decisions, announced at 2:00 PM Eastern Time (7:00 AM Tonga time), can move markets significantly. European Central Bank (ECB) rate decisions, at 1:15 PM Central European Time (12:15 AM Tonga time), affect European indices like the DAX and FTSE 100. For Asian indices like the Nikkei 225 and Hang Seng, key events include the Bank of Japan (BOJ) policy announcements (often early morning Tonga time) and Chinese GDP data (released around 10:00 AM China Standard Time, which is 3:00 PM Tonga time). Tongan traders should also monitor the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A) decisions, as Australia is a major trading partner and the Australian dollar can influence market sentiment. Given Tonga's time zone (UTC+13), many US and European events occur during Tongan night or early morning, so traders may need to set alerts or use pending orders. Economic calendars from brokers like Pepperstone or XM Group provide filtered data for indices traders.

Slippage Analysis

Slippage β€” the difference between the expected price of a trade and the price actually executed β€” is a real concern for Tongan traders due to geographic distance from major liquidity hubs. When you trade indices from Tonga, your order passes through multiple internet nodes before reaching the broker’s server in London or New York, adding 200–400 ms of latency. During high-volatility events (e.g., US non-farm payrolls), this delay can cause slippage of 1–3 pips on indices like the S&P 500. Brokers with market execution (e.g., Pepperstone, IC Markets) are more prone to slippage, while those with instant execution (e.g., AvaTrade, XM Group) may requote you instead. To minimize slippage, trade during low-volatility periods β€” for Tonga, that’s the Asian session (9:00 PM–6:00 AM local time) when indices like the Nikkei 225 are active but less volatile than the US session. Also, use limit orders instead of market orders when possible. Pepperstone’s raw-spread account offers minimal slippage on indices due to its deep liquidity pool, but you’ll pay a commission. For smaller traders, XM Group’s instant execution model may be safer, as it guarantees fills at the quoted price β€” though requotes can be frustrating.

VPS Trading

A Virtual Private Server (VPS) is essential for Tongan traders running automated strategies or scalping indices, because it reduces latency and keeps your platform running 24/7. From Tonga, your home internet may suffer outages or throttling β€” a VPS hosted in London or New York (where the indices are traded) can cut ping times from 300 ms to under 5 ms. Brokers like Pepperstone (4.4/5) and Fusion Markets (3.9/5) offer free VPS hosting for clients with a minimum trading volume (e.g., $500 monthly commission or 10 lots). IC Markets also provides a free VPS for active traders. If you are a beginner, a VPS may be overkill β€” but if you scalp the S&P 500 during the US session (2:30 AM in Tonga), it ensures your trades execute without interruption. Setup is simple: choose a VPS provider (e.g., AWS or broker-partnered), install your MetaTrader 4/5 platform, and link it to your broker account. For Tonga, where electricity can be unstable, a VPS also protects against local power cuts. Exness and OctaFX do not offer free VPS, but their mobile apps are robust alternatives for manual trading.

How This Compares

Should you trade indices CFDs or individual stocks? For Tonga traders, indices offer diversification with a single trade β€” buying the S&P 500 gives you exposure to 500 US companies, while buying a single stock like Apple exposes you to company-specific risk. Indices also have lower margin requirements (e.g., 5% margin on the FTSE 100 with Pepperstone) compared to individual stocks (often 10–20% margin). However, indices CFDs are subject to overnight swap fees (positive or negative), while stock CFDs may have dividend adjustments. For Tongan traders with limited capital, indices are more cost-effective: XM Group allows trading the S&P 500 with a $5 deposit, whereas buying one share of Apple CFD would require $150+ in margin. On the downside, indices move slower than individual stocks, so day traders may prefer volatile stocks like Tesla. Our recommendation: start with indices for steady returns and lower risk, then graduate to individual stocks as you gain experience. AvaTrade and eToro both offer stock CFDs alongside indices, allowing you to switch between asset classes easily. For long-term investors in Tonga, indices are a better hedge against inflation than holding paΚ»anga cash.

When researching indices brokers from Tonga, it is vital to be aware of potential scams. Always verify a broker's regulatory status using the official regulator's website (e.g., FCA, ASIC, CySEC) before depositing funds. Scammers often create fake websites that mimic legitimate brokers like Pepperstone or AvaTrade, so check the URL carefully. Tonga does not have a local financial regulator for forex or CFDs, so you must rely on international regulators. Be cautious of brokers promising guaranteed returns or extremely high leverage without risk, as these are common red flags. For example, a broker claiming to be regulated by the 'Tonga Financial Services Authority' (which does not exist) is likely a scam. Also, avoid brokers that pressure you to deposit quickly or offer bonuses that seem too good to be true. Legitimate brokers like Exness, IC Markets, and XM Group clearly display their regulatory licenses on their websites. Check for negative reviews on independent forums like Trustpilot or Forex Peace Army. Additionally, never share your account password or personal information via email or phone. If a broker asks for payment via cryptocurrency or wire transfer to an unverified account, it is a major warning sign. Always use the payment methods listed on the broker's official website. For Tongan traders, it is also wise to start with a small deposit to test the broker's withdrawal process before committing larger funds. Remember, if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.
